原文:[Android Pro] Android libdvm.so 與 libart.so

reference to http: blog.csdn.net koffuxu article details Android libdvm.so 與 libart.so 系統升級到 . 之后,發現system lib 下面沒有libdvm.so了,只剩下了libart.so。對於libart模式,從 . 就在Developer optins里面就可以手動選擇,到 . 算是轉正了。 ,什么是li ...

2016-07-17 13:57 0 1698 推薦指數:

查看詳情

android調試系列--使用ida pro調試so

1、工具介紹 IDA pro: 反匯編神器,可靜態分析和動態調試。 模擬機或者真機:運行要調試的程序。 樣本:阿里安全挑戰賽第二題:http://pan.baidu.com/s/1eS9EXIM 2、前期准備 2.1 安裝樣本程序 2.2 上傳 ...

Fri Jun 17 23:03:00 CST 2016 0 8515
[Android Pro] so 動態加載—解決sdk過大問題

原文地址: https://blog.csdn.net/Rong_L/article/details/75212472 前言 相信Android 開發中大家或多或少都會集成一些第三方sdk, 而其中難免要會使用到他們的so文件。但有時,你會發現這些so文件過多,對於一些需要經常更新的應用 ...

Fri Nov 23 22:31:00 CST 2018 0 1042
Android so文件進階 <一>

0x00 前言 最近一段時間在弄android方面的東西,今天有人發了張截圖,問:在要dump多大的內存?    一時之間我竟然想不起來ELF文件的哪個字段表示的是文件大小,雖然最后給出了解決方法,IDA CTRL+S,直接看Segements信息,可以得出整個文件的大小。但說明 ...

Wed Oct 28 04:40:00 CST 2015 0 8230
Android so加載原理

一、概述   本節介紹一下so的加載原理,促使我寫這個小節的原因有兩點:   1.可以在給App瘦身的時候提供參考依據   2.可以給so插件化提供參考依據   下面就開始看so的加載原理吧。 二、so加載原理分析   2.1.so的編譯類型   在Android中只支持三種CPU ...

Mon Mar 16 05:54:00 CST 2020 0 756
android so加載

  本文分析so加載的步驟,其實在之前dalvik淺析二中也有提及,但那重點關注的是jni。androidso庫的加載,代碼如下:   我們來看下它的執行流程吧: 先調用dlopen來載入so文件;find_library在soinfo結構(進程加載的so鏈)中查找當前 ...

Fri Nov 20 05:50:00 CST 2015 0 2034
Android 動態加載 .SO

需求: 有時候應用修復了native層一個小BUG,應用需要更新了,但是用戶必須下載整個APK包進行安裝,而我們需要的只是替換SO 於是想,能不能加載自定義路徑下的 SO 文件呢 答案是完全沒問題: 使用系統方法: 但是有一點,pathName 路徑必須有執行權限,意思 ...

Sun Jun 23 16:57:00 CST 2013 6 6424
Android如何使用so文件和Android studio中導入so

Android中使用so文件: 做一個PDF閱讀的功能,找到一個開源的庫,mupdf。下載的是網上編譯好的so庫,導入到自己項目中的時候一直報錯Java.lang.UnsatisfiedLinkError: Couldn't load netplayerlibq: findLibrary ...

Tue Dec 27 05:17:00 CST 2016 0 24108
android so殼入口淺析

本文轉自http://www.9hao.info/pages/2014/08/android-soke-ru-kou-q 前言   開年來開始接觸一些加固樣本,基本都對了so進行了處理,拖入ida一看,要么沒有 JNI_OnLoad ,要么 JNI_OnLoad 匯編代碼羞澀難懂 ...

Mon Sep 22 08:16:00 CST 2014 0 2157
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M